IT’S tree cheers for Prince Charles as, watched by the Queen, he plants a sapling to mark his mother’s Platinum Jubilee next year.
The oak was dug in at Windsor Castle and the prince is urging the nation to do the same. Backed by the Queen and Boris Johnson, Charles wants to turn her 70 years on the throne into an environmental initiative – the Queen’s Green Canopy.
The Queen has herself planted more than 1,500 trees around the world during her reign. In a video message last night Charles pointed to the role that trees play in helping combat climate change and habitat loss.
He suggested individuals could plant a single sapling in their garden. Schools or community groups could plant a tree.
